The Roads and Traffic Authority (RTA) has set up rules for the ownership and function of classic cars in the UAE. There are six classic car categories in the UAE, namely they are categories A, B, C, D, E, and F. Category A comprises vehicles that are limited to only 10,000 km of mileage per year while the least enable category, category F comprises vehicles that can only be used for showroom purposes. In order to operate a classic car in the UAE an inspection and car registration must be undergone which can cost a total of AED 850.
Cars 30 years or older are considered classic cars in Dubai. Whereas in some areas across the globe 20 years is the minimum age of a classic car.
Yes. To import a classic car to Dubai, you must have a valid local visa, a local drivers license, and have the Roads and Transport Authority (RTA) check your car before it is imported from its country of origin. It is important that the car not be damaged for it to pass the screening.
